Shares of Kootenay Silver Inc. (CVE:KTN - Get Free Report) fell 0.8% on Tuesday . The stock traded as low as C$1.17 and last traded at C$1.20. 317,536 shares changed hands during mid-day trading, an increase of 204% from the average session volume of 104,362 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$1.21.
Kootenay Silver Stock Performance
The firm has a fifty day simple moving average of C$0.99 and a 200-day simple moving average of C$0.99. The stock has a market cap of C$76.13 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-18.20 and a beta of 0.01. The company has a current ratio of 39.98, a quick ratio of 47.87 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.33.

Kootenay Silver Inc, an exploration stage company, engages in the acquisition, exploration, and development of mineral properties in Mexico and Canada. The company explores for silver, gold, lead, and zinc ores. It primarily holds interests in the La Cigarra silver project covering an area of approximately 18,000 hectares located within the Parral Mining District in the state of Chihuahua, north central Mexico; Promontorio and La Negra silver discoveries situated in Sonora, Mexico; Columba Silver project located in Chihuahua, Mexico; and Copalito Silver-gold project located in Sinaloa, Mexico.
